How Robots Navigate from the Laboratory to the Streets: Insights from the 2026 World Robotics Conference

On February 2, 2026, the World Robotics Conference will address the challenges and advancements in robotics as it relates to how robots transition from research labs to real-world applications. This event will highlight the importance of addressing the “human” versus “automation” dynamic, a critical consideration for all robotics companies.

At the conference, key discussions will focus on the “ten-year contract” which aims to address long-term societal implications of robotics. This initiative is projected to be valued at approximately 200 billion dollars, marking a significant step for the robotic industry.

As data utilization becomes increasingly integrated into everyday applications, the conference will explore how advanced data processing can enhance robotic capabilities. The discussions will also touch on the synergy between artificial intelligence and robotics, emphasizing the need for continued collaboration between sectors.

1. The “ten-year contract” signifies a commitment to humanity: The emergence of robots is not merely about solving immediate issues; it reflects a long-term vision for societal integration of robotics.

2. Data training can enhance robotic efficiency: Unlike traditional human-centric processes, robots can utilize “simulated integration as primary and real data as secondary” to facilitate learning and adaptability.

3. The combination of “simulation + industry”: The integration of simulation technologies and industry practices will lead to improved performance and efficiency in robotic applications.

4. From “single function” to “multi-functional”: As robots become more complex, their capabilities will evolve to address both speed and agility, significantly enhancing their applications in various sectors.
